. ∠J and ∠M are base angles of isosceles trapezoid JKLM. If m∠J = 18x + 8, and m∠M = 11x + 15, find m∠K. 3

Answer:

164

Step-by-step explanation:

Remark

The two base angles are equal. That means that

<M = <J

18x + 8 = 11x + 15        Subtract 8 from both sides

18x  = 11x + 15 - 8       Combine      

18x = 11x + 7               Subtract 11x from both sides

18x - 11x = 7               Combine

7x = 7                        Divide by 7

x = 7/7

x = 1            

Find J

<J = 18x + 8

<J = 18*1 + 8

<J = 26

Find K

<K is supplementary to <J

<K + <J = 180

<K + 26 = 180

<K = 180 - 26

<K = 164

The point (–3, –5) is on the graph of a function. What equation must be true regarding the function?
Komok [63]

The equation that must be true regarding the function is a. f(–3) = –5

<h3>How to explain the information?</h3>

The point (–3, –5) is on the graph of a function. Which equation must be true regarding the function?

a. f(–3) = –5

b. f(–3, –5) = –8

c. f(–5) = –3

d. f(–5, –3) = –2

The question is what does the point (-3, -5) correspond to on the graph of the function.

If we have a point on a graph in the Cartesian coordinate system then that point consists of coordinates (x, y). In other words, y=f(x) and x so (x, f(x)) where x is a x-coordinate and y=f(x) is y-coordinate.

Hence if we have a point (-3, -5) the corresponding coordinates are x=-3 and y=f(x)=-5.

Therefore the correct answer is f(-3)=-5.
